Management Commentary

During the associated the previous quarter earnings call, KHC leadership focused discussions on operational efficiency gains implemented in recent months, including targeted supply chain optimizations, waste reduction initiatives, and cross-segment cost control measures across its North American and international operating units. Management noted that pricing adjustments rolled out in prior periods continued to support gross margin stability during the quarter, though they acknowledged that demand volume trends varied across the company’s product portfolio. Specifically, shelf-stable pantry staples saw relatively consistent demand, while refrigerated and convenience food lines experienced more variable consumer uptake tied to fluctuating in-home dining rates. Leadership also highlighted ongoing investments in brand marketing and product innovation, including expansions of its better-for-you product lines and plant-based food offerings, as core priorities to retain and grow market share amid heightened competition in the packaged food space. Forward Guidance

Alongside the the previous quarter results, KHC shared qualitative forward guidance for upcoming operating periods, noting that the company could see potential ongoing pressure from commodity cost fluctuations, logistics expenses, and changing consumer price sensitivity in the near term. The company did not provide specific quantitative EPS or revenue targets for future periods in the initial public release, noting that it would share more detailed financial projections alongside its full regulatory filing. Management did confirm that planned capital expenditures for the coming period would likely be focused on production capacity upgrades, digital transformation of distribution operations, and continued R&D investment in new product development. Analysts covering the consumer staples sector estimate that KHC’s guidance aligns with broader sector expectations, with most large packaged food firms flagging similar cost headwinds in recent public commentary. Market Reaction

Following the release of KHC’s the previous quarter earnings results, the company’s shares saw normal trading activity in subsequent sessions, with no significant abnormal price swings observed in immediate after-hours trading following the announcement. Sell-side analysts covering KHC have noted that the reported $0.67 EPS figure aligns roughly with pre-release consensus market expectations, though the lack of disclosed revenue data has led some analysts to flag pending regulatory filings for additional color on top-line performance. Trading volume for KHC in the sessions following the release was within normal historical ranges, with available market positioning data showing that institutional investors largely held existing positions in the firm following the results. Sector analysts have noted that KHC’s Q4 performance is consistent with broader trends in the packaged food space, where cost control efforts have been a larger driver of bottom-line results than top-line growth for many firms in recent periods.
